Summary

The Watershed Education Scholarship, offered by the North Bay Watershed Association (NBWA), provides financial support for students of all ages who reside or work within the NBWA boundary. This scholarship aims to fund educational endeavors in environmental sciences, engineering, or water industry certifications. With awards up to $1,000 announced annually, the NBWA encourages projects that promote stewardship and benefit the entire North Bay watershed community.

About the Program The North Bay Watershed Association (NBWA) has worked diligently for more than twenty years on water resource issues that go beyond traditional boundaries to promote stewardship of the North Bay watersheds. The NBWA is proud to sponsor and support local organizations and individuals in our regional community through providing selective local small grants and scholarships. The NBWA is always interested to learn about projects and initiatives that inform, engage, and enhance our north bay watershed communities. Importantly, our projects are encouraged to be developed, piloted, or implemented by a local proponent with a design plan to distribute derivative benefits to the entire region. Watershed Education Scholarship The North Bay Watershed Association (NBWA) offers a scholarship to help fund educational opportunities for students of all ages who reside or work within the NBWA boundary, which encompasses all lands draining to the San Pablo Bay, who intend to enter, or are currently enrolled in high school, vocational school, trade school, technical school, accredited university, or two-year or four-year college to pursue studies in the environmental sciences, engineering, or pursuing water industry certifications or training. Up to $1,000 per scholarship Scholarships announced annually and awarded as applicable

Open to any ageReside or work within the NBWA boundary, which encompasses all lands draining to the San Pablo Bay A student is an individual of any age who is actively engaged in learning or educational pursuits. This can include individuals enrolled in formal education programs such as primary, secondary, or higher education institutions, as well as those participating in informal education, professional development, or lifelong learning activities. The student demonstrates a commitment to personal growth, knowledge acquisition, and skill development through various academic, vocational, or self-directed learning experiences.
